Selim Yavuz is a scholar working on Hematology, Genetics and Rheumatology. According to data from OpenAlex, Selim Yavuz has authored 9 papers receiving a total of 92 indexed citations (citations by other indexed papers that have themselves been cited), including 4 papers in Hematology, 3 papers in Genetics and 3 papers in Rheumatology. Recurrent topics in Selim Yavuz's work include Acute Myeloid Leukemia Research (2 papers), Acute Lymphoblastic Leukemia research (2 papers) and Eosinophilic Disorders and Syndromes (2 papers). Selim Yavuz is often cited by papers focused on Acute Myeloid Leukemia Research (2 papers), Acute Lymphoblastic Leukemia research (2 papers) and Eosinophilic Disorders and Syndromes (2 papers). Selim Yavuz collaborates with scholars based in Türkiye. Selim Yavuz's co-authors include Vedat Hamuryudan, S Yurdakul, İzzet Fresko, Havva Yazıcı, Seniha Başaran, Mustafa Nuri Yenerel, Semra Çalangu, Atahan Çağatay, Kenan Midilli and Haluk Eraksoy and has published in prestigious journals such as Nephrology Dialysis Transplantation, Journal of Medical Microbiology and American Journal of Hematology.
